Abstract :
We propose a method for estimating the locations of the causes of failure or deterioration in quality in the service function chains (SFCs) of datacenter networks by using tests packets. Our method is especially effective in service-quality deterioration where no alarms are notified from physical and virtual components. This method models SFC configurations by creating a correlation ID, which identifies a correlation between physical network elements and virtualized elements of the SFC components to enable us to find the components common to all SFCs that are either in failure or deteriorating. We consider such common components as locations where service problems can occur in SFCs. As a result of applying this method to SFCs in datacenter networks, it drastically reduced the number of candidate causes and computation time.
